  • AMF Automatic Durabowl Part

    Hi All.

    On the piston for these is the screw in connector for the air line. I have a few that have developed leaks. From the looks of the manuals you can not order this part seperately to replace. What is it called? Any one have some sort of specs for them so I can try and hunt some down and replace them?

    Thanks muchly!

    Will

  • #2
    We were told here by our Qubica rep we had to buy new pistons.... as the connector elbow thingy doesn't have a part number on its own...

    • #3
      718 810 033 Quick Connect L

        • #5
          I would imagine since it uses standard 1/4" tubing you can find these connectors at the local hardware store. They may be a little different but as long as it threads into the cylinder and securely connects the tubing it will be fine.

          Comment


          • #6
            Originally posted by Tablejam View Post
            I would imagine since it uses standard 1/4" tubing you can find these connectors at the local hardware store. They may be a little different but as long as it threads into the cylinder and securely connects the tubing it will be fine.
            Agree. I've bought them at Lowes and Home Depot. There are 2 types, though. The latest I bought was just the push-in type 1/4" tubing connector. Works just fine. The earlier type is plastic compression - turn to tighten. I've seen them as well in the big box stores.
